PhD Studentship: Post-Quantum Zero-Knowledge Proofs and Trustworthy AI
This PhD studentship focuses on developing post-quantum zero-knowledge proof systems and integrating them with trustworthy AI, enabling verifiable and privacy-preserving machine learning. The research will explore lattice- or code-based cryptographic methods, scalable proof constructions for decentralised AI, and formal security analysis in real-world applications, with access to advanced computing and robotics testbeds through collaboration with DSTL.
